Tim is filling a new sandbox with play sand. The sandbox can hold up to 25 cubic feet of sand before it's too full. The sand Tim needs comes in bags containing 0.5 cubic feet of sand. Let x represent how many bags of sand Tim can pour into the sandbox before it's too full. Which inequality describes the problem?
